Production process

From upload to doorstep in five clear steps

You always know where your project stands. Our process is designed to be predictable, communicative, and fast — without cutting corners on the shop floor.

  1. Step 01

    File review & consultation

    We inspect your STL, OBJ, or STEP file for printability issues, recommend orientation and material, and confirm specs before anything hits the printer.

  2. Step 02

    Slicing & scheduling

    Our technicians optimize layer height, infill, and support structures for your material and use case, then slot the job into the production queue.

  3. Step 03

    Printing & monitoring

    Parts are printed on calibrated FDM or SLA equipment with live monitoring. Failed layers trigger automatic pauses so nothing ships substandard.

  4. Step 04

    Post-processing & finishing

    Supports are removed, surfaces are cleaned or smoothed, and optional finishing — sanding, priming, painting, or vapor smoothing — is applied.

  5. Step 05

    Quality check & shipping

    Every order passes a final inspection, is photographed for your records, and ships in protective packaging with tracking the same or next business day.

Equipment overview

The right tool for every job

We invest in production-grade equipment and maintain it on a strict calibration schedule. That means fewer failed prints, tighter tolerances, and materials your project actually needs.

FDM / FFF
Industrial FDM farm
A fleet of enclosed, high-temperature FDM printers capable of engineering plastics — ABS, ASA, nylon, and carbon-fiber composites — with build volumes up to 300 × 300 × 400 mm.
  • ±0.1 mm accuracy
  • 12+ materials
  • 24/7 unattended printing
SLA / Resin
Resin printing suite
High-resolution SLA systems for miniatures, dental models, jewelry masters, and any part where surface finish and fine detail matter more than structural bulk.
  • 25–50 μm layer height
  • Smooth surface finish
  • Multiple resin types
Scanning
3D scanning & reverse engineering
Structured-light and laser scanners capture physical objects at sub-millimeter accuracy. We clean meshes, align geometry, and deliver print-ready files.
  • 0.05 mm scan accuracy
  • Mesh repair included
  • CAD conversion available
Post-processing
Finishing & assembly station
Dedicated workstations for support removal, sanding, vapor smoothing, priming, painting, thread tapping, and heat-set insert installation.
